Discover Kidapawan
Kidapawan is the capital city of Cotabato Province with a rapidly growing population of more than 161,000 (2020). It's probably the best jumping-off point if you wish to climb Mount Apo, the Philippines' highest mountain.

Getting There
Multiple OptionsYou can connect from Davao, Cotabato City or Valencia. There are buses and mini-buses (typically Toyota Hi-Ace) going to and from Davao City that take about 2 hr 45 min for the journey. The nearest airport is in Davao City, and you can buy tickets for Philippines Airlines or Cebu Pacific airlines from an agent at the Gaisano Grand Mall from 10AM-7PM. Language & Talk
Cebuano is the dominant language spoken in Kidapawan. Other settlers speak Hiligaynon, Ilocano and Maguindanao. Most of the people can also speak Tagalog (Filipino) and English.
